I am writting constructing a table using proc report. One of the columns being displayed is a list of percentages

 

PercentUsed

99.267561

0.2447182

0.4967894

76.229856

 

How can I format this colum so that it appears as what is shown below, within the proc report table. 

 

PercentUsed

99.26%

0.24%

0.49%

76.2%

 

If I use the format=percent it times eveything by 100. So I get 9926 rather then 99.26

Create a PICTURE format like this:

proc format;

   picture pcent low-high='009.99%';

run;

 

 data _null_;

   PercentUsed = 99.34567;

   x = put(PercentUsed, pcent.);

   put x=;

run;

x=99.34%
